I have an '03 Cavalier with about 49000 miles on it. Recently my drivers side window started to act funny, it would roll down fine but when rolling it up it would stop about half way up. After driving a little more it would roll up a little more, this would continue until it was completely rolled up. Then one day it stopped rolling down altogether and was just stuck in the up position. Then a couple days later it went back to the previous problem of rolling down and not going all the way back up. My question is if this sounds like a problem with the motor or the switch or possibly the connection between the two.

its the window regualtor which comes with a motor, th reason its working once in a while is probably from hitting bumps, hope this helps
